The new face of philanthropy: The role of intrinsic motivation in millennials' attitudes and intent to donate to charitable organizations

M Gorczyca, RL Hartman
Link Copied!

This article explores the "new face of philanthropy" by investigating the role of intrinsic motivation in millennials' attitudes and intentions to donate to charitable organizations. It examines what drives this younger generation to engage in philanthropic activities, distinguishing their motivations from previous generations. The authors analyze how factors such as personal values, a desire for impact, and alignment with organizational missions influence millennials' willingness to contribute, providing insights for charitable organizations seeking to engage this demographic effectively.
